Rutledge Borough Council Meeting- January 6, 2014

 

David Waltz, Council President, opened the scheduled Borough Council Meeting at 7:30 PM, in the Council Meeting Room, 212 Unity Terrace, Rutledge, PA.

 

After the salute to the flag, the following Council members answered roll call: M. Diane McGaughey, Marlaina Kloepfer, David Waltz, Brian Costello, Marie Govannicci, Tom Kopp, Daniel Werner,

 

Also present: Mayor Kevin Cunningham, Officer Stufflett, Robert Hunt, Jr., Esq.

 

Minutes:  MOTION by James Jones, Second by Diane McGaughey, to approve the minutes as submitted for the Council Meeting of December 9, 2013. Daniel Werner stated that, under Public Comment, it should state that the police were called because the dogs were barking. MOTION approved unanimously with noted change.

 

MOTION by Daniel Werner, Second by Diane McGaughey, to approve the minutes as submitted for the Work Session of December 23, 2013. MOTION approved unanimously.

 

Public Comment: None

 

Treasurer’s Report: Gennifer Guiliano distributed the Treasurer’s Report for the month of December, 2013, and noted that the General Fund has a balance of $369.00 until 2014 taxes are collected.

 

Correspondence:

 

  1. Delaware County- $50,000.00 to repair Swarthmore Ave.
  2. PSAB- Training for New Council Members-various dates and locations
  3. James Jones- Letter of resignation from the Zoning Hearing Board.

     

    Tax Collector’s Report: Thomas Heron reported that $402,096.44 was collected as of 12/31/13. Accounts receivable as of 12 /31/13- 16 Real Estate taxes, 7 Sewer and 29 Per Capita – $31,931.60. Mr. Heron ordered the 2014 tax bills, which will be sent out on February 1, 2014.

    Solicitor’s Report: Robert Hunt reported that there will be a Zoning Hearing on Thursday, January 23, 2014, at 7:30 PM. James Jones resigned from the Zoning Hearing Board, and there are two new members. Mr. Hunt drafted a continuance for Mr. Jones to sign, since the hearing will be after 60 of the date of his application.

    Sale of 206 Linden Ave.- the sale has not been processed- it should be completed by January 20, 2014.

    Old Business: Tom Kopp repaired the elevator. A 3-year test is required by the State by the end of March. Mr. Kopp recommended that the Borough get a maintenance contract.
